2. INTRODUCCIÓN
Las bases de datos son recursos que
recopilan todo tipo de información, para
atender las necesidades de un amplio
grupo de usuarios. Su tipología es
variada y se caracterizan por una alta
estructuración y estandarización de la
información.
3. Que es una base de datos?
Se define una base de datos como una
serie de datos organizados y relacionados
entre sí, los cuales son recolectados y
explotados por los sistemas de
información de una empresa o negocio en
particular.
4. Es el conjunto de informaciones almacenadas en un
soporte legible por ordenador y organizadas
internamente por registros (formado por todos los
campos referidos a una entidad u objeto almacenado) y
campos (cada uno de los elementos que componen un
registro). Permite recuperar cualquier clase de
información:
referencias,
documentos
textuales, imágenes, datos estadísticos, etc.
Una base de datos es una colección de información
organizada de forma que un programa de ordenador
pueda seleccionar rápidamente los fragmentos de datos
que necesite. Una base de datos es un sistema de
archivos electrónico.
5. Una base de datos o banco de datos es un conjunto de
datos pertenecientes a un mismo contexto y
almacenados sistemáticamente para su posterior uso. En
este sentido; una biblioteca puede considerarse una base
de datos compuesta en su mayoría por documentos y
textos impresos en papel e indexados para su consulta.
Actualmente, y debido al desarrollo tecnológico de
campos como la informática y la electrónica, la mayoría
de las bases de datos están en formato digital
(electrónico), y por ende se ha desarrollado y se ofrece
un amplio rango de soluciones al problema del
almacenamiento de datos.
6. Orígenes y Antecedentes
Sus orígenes surgen desde mediados de
los años sesenta la historia de las bases
de datos, en 1970 Codd propuso el
modelo relacional, este modelo es el
que ha marcado la línea de investigación
por muchos años, ahora se encuentran
los modelos orientados a objetos.
7. VENTAJAS DEL USO DE LA
BASE DE DATOS
1) Independencia de datos y tratamiento.
Cambio en datos no implica cambio en programas y viceversa
(Menor coste de mantenimiento).
2) Coherencia de resultados.
Reduce redundancia :
Acciones lógicamente únicas.
Se evita inconsistencia.
3) Mejora en la disponibilidad de datos
No hay dueño de datos (No igual a ser públicos).
Ni aplicaciones ni usuarios.
Guardamos descripción (Idea de catálogos).
8. Características de los Sistemas de
Base De Datos
Independencia lógica y física de los datos.
Redundancia mínima.
Acceso concurrente por parte de múltiples usuarios.
Integridad de los datos.
Consultas complejas optimizadas.
Seguridad de acceso y auditoría.
Respaldo y recuperación.
Acceso a través de lenguajes de programación estándar.
9. Sistema de Gestión de Base de
Datos (SGBD)
Los Sistemas de Gestión de Base de Datos (en
inglés DataBase Management System) son un tipo
de software muy específico, dedicado a servir de
interfaz entre la base de datos, el usuario y las
aplicaciones que la utilizan. Se compone de un
lenguaje de definición de datos, de un lenguaje de
manipulación de datos y de un lenguaje de
consulta.
10. Estructura de una Base de Datos
Una base de datos, a fin de ordenar la
información de manera lógica, posee un
orden que debe ser cumplido para acceder a
la información de manera coherente. Cada
base de datos contiene una o más tablas, que
cumplen la función de contener los campos.
11. Por consiguiente una base de datos posee el
siguiente orden jerárquico:
Tablas
Campos
Registros
Lenguaje SQL
12. El conjunto unificado de información, resultante de nuestro
proyecto informático y, que será compartida por los
diferentes usuarios de la organización, va a conformar la
denominada Base de Datos.
La función básica de una base de datos es permitir el
almacenamiento y la recuperación de la información
necesaria, para que las personas de la organización puedan
tomar decisiones. Es así que las Bases de Datos se tornan
esenciales para la supervivencia de cualquier organización;
pues los datos estructurados constituyen un recurso básico
para todas las organizaciones.
Dependiendo de la capacidad de almacenamiento y
procesamiento del hardware, la organización puede contar
con una única Base de Datos, o con múltiples Bases de Datos.
13. Una Base de Datos está compuesta por un conjunto de tablas o
archivos. Para una mayor comprensión podemos ejemplificar la
siguiente Base de Datos de compras.
ARCHIVO DE PRODUCTOS
Código artículo
Descripción del material
Unidad
Cantidad
1.01.01
1.01.02
CD-ROM RW IDE
Disco rígido ATA 66
Unidad
Unidad
10
20
1.02.01
Disco Flexible de 3 1/2" 1,44 Mbytes
Caja de 10
20
2.01.01
Sonido de 16 bit
Unidad
5
3.01.01
Papel carta para impresora.
Resma 100 hojas
25
4.01.01
Pentium II 200Mhz
Unidad
7
4.01.02
Pentium III 500Mhz
Unidad
8
4.01.03
Pentium III 800Mhz
Unidad
9
14. ARCHIVO DE PROVEEDORES
Código proveedor
Nombre del proveedor
Teléfono del proveedor
Dirección del proveedor
001
002
Inca Tel
Infocad
4923-4803
4633-2520
Av. La Plata 365
Doblas 1578
003
Herrera Compusistem
4232-7711
Av. Rivadavia 3558
ARCHIVO DE ORIGEN DE LOS PRODUCTOS
Código proveedor
Código del artículo
Precio
001
002
1.01.01
1.01.01
70,00
80,00
003
1.01.01
75,00
002
2.01.01
50
001
4.01.03
450
15. Esta Base de Datos contiene información de tres
Entidades:
Datos sobre productos (Entidad producto),
almacenados en el archivo de PRODUCTOS;
Datos sobre proveedores (Entidad proveedores),
almacenados en el archivo PROVEEDORES y;
Datos sobre el origen de los productos (Entidad
origen del producto), o sea, los productos son
provistos por cada proveedor y viceversa,
almacenados en el archivo de ORIGEN DEL
PRODUCTO.
16. La información almacenada en cada uno de estos archivos se
conoce con el nombre de Entidad. Por lo tanto una entidad es
cualquier persona, cosa o evento, real o imaginario, de interés
para la organización y acerca del cual se capturan, almacenan
o procesan datos.
Además, cada uno de estos archivos está formado por un
conjunto de registros que describe, a través de los atributos o
datos (columna), cada entidad en él almacenado. Un atributo
es pues, cualquier detalle que sirve para
identificar, clasificar, cuantificar o expresar el estado de una
entidad.
Todos los registros de un archivo, identificados por las filas de
cada tabla, poseen el mismo formato, o sea tienen el mismo
conjunto de datos o atributos, identificados por las